Sars-COV-2 (COVID-19) Immunity in immunoCOmpromised Populations

SARS CoV 2 InfectionCOVID-19

The immune response of COVID-19 vaccination was monitored and studied in the context of the previously PICOV study (P2020/424), Nephro- VAC studies (P2020/284 and P2020/312) and Lung-VAC study (P2021/182). The constant emergence of new variants of concern (VOCs), which become increasingly better at escaping infection and vaccine induced immune responses, together with waning immunity over time, warrant additional vaccination rounds. This is especially true in immunocompromised populations. In the current study, we want to continue monitoring SARS-CoV-2 specific immunity over the next two years, encompassing several future vaccination campaigns.

Sequential Enhanced Safety Study of a Novel Coronavirus Messenger RNA (mRNA) Vaccine in Adults Aged...

Corona Virus Disease 2019(COVID-19)

This trial is a clinical study to evaluate the safety of sequential boosters of novel coronavirus mRNA vaccine in adults aged 18 years and older who have completed three doses of novel inactivated coronavirus vaccination. According to the results of the previous phase I clinical trial, the incidence of adverse reactions in the 0.3 ml dose group was lower than that in the 0.5 ml dose group, and the degree of adverse reactions was weaker. The dose of 0.3ml was chosen for the current study, and a 1-dose immunization program was completed for safety observation.

Rehabilitation of Critically Ill Patients With SARS-CoV-2 Variants in ICU With Limited Resources...

COVID-19 Acute Respiratory Distress Syndrome

Acute rehabilitation in critically ill patients can improve post-intensive care unit (post-ICU) physical function. Scientific evidence has considered neuromuscular electrical stimulation (NMES) as a promising approach for the early rehabilitation of patients during and/or after ICU. Neuromuscular electrostimulation can be an alternative form of muscle exercise that helps to gain strength in critically ill patients with COVID -19, due to the severe weakness that patients experience due to longer MV, analgesia and NMB duration. Thus, the general objective of evaluating the effects of an early rehabilitation protocol on the strength and functionality of patients affected by SARS-CoV-2 variants and specifically compare the effectiveness of NMES associated with the functional rehabilitation protocol(FR). Also, describe demographics, clinical status, ICU therapies, mortality estimates and Hospital outcomes, of every patients admitted in ICU during the observation periods.

Randomized Controlled Trial of the Mindful Compassion Care Program in Reducing Psychological Distress...

BurnoutCOVID-19

Recent studies have shown that nurses have been more affected by the COVID-19 pandemic than any other group of hospital workers in terms of anxiety, depression, and burnout. Several clinical studies had previously demonstrated the effectiveness of mindfulness and compassion interventions in reducing burnout and emotional distress amongst healthcare professionals. A parallel-group randomized controlled trial will assess the feasibility, acceptability, and efficacy of a mindfulness and compassion-focused programme on frontline nurses who had been working during the COVID-19 pandemic. Seventy-two participants will be divided equally into an intervention group and a control group. Primary outcome will be assessed using the Emotional Exhaustion subscale of the Maslach Burnout Inventory General Survey (MBI-GS). Secondary outcomes will be measured by the Cynicism and Professional Efficacy subscales of the MBI-GS; the Patient Health Questionnaire (PHQ-9); the Generalized Anxiety Disorder (GAD-7); the Insomnia Severity Index (ISI); the Impact of Stressful Events (IES-R); the Perceived Stress Scale (PSS); the Five Facet Mindfulness Questionnaire (FFMQ); and the Forms of Self-Criticising/attacking and Self-Reassuring Scale (FSCRS). The study aims to fill a gap in the literature and present a scientifically validated intervention for those healthcare professionals most exposed to the stressful conditions of working during the COVID-19 pandemic.

Brain and Gut Plasticity in Mild TBI or Post-acute COVID Syndrome Following Growth Hormone Therapy...

Traumatic Brain InjuryFatigue2 more

Patients with a history of mild traumatic brain injury (mTBI) or post acute sequelae of SARS-CoV-2 (PASC) and abnormal growth hormone secretion, as measured by glucagon stimulation test, will be treated with replacement growth hormone therapy for a period of 6 months (mTBI) or 9 months (PASC). Testing of cognition, exercise, fatigue, brain activation and morphology, body composition and measurements of quality of life will be performed before and after the treatment period. Fecal sampling for characterization of the GI microbiome will occur monthly over the treatment period. Control subjects will be enrolled and will provide fecal samples monthly for 6 months. GI microbiomes will be compared between mTBI patients, PASC patients and controls at baseline as well as over the treatment period.

Nitric Oxide Gas Inhalation Therapy for Mild/Moderate COVID-19

Coronavirus InfectionsPneumonia2 more

The scientific community is in search for novel therapies that can help to face the ongoing epidemics of novel Coronavirus (SARS-Cov-2) originated in China in December 2019. At present, there are no proven interventions to prevent progression of the disease. Some preliminary data on SARS pneumonia suggest that inhaled Nitric Oxide (NO) could have beneficial effects on SARS-CoV-2 due to the genomic similarities between this two coronaviruses. In this study we will test whether inhaled NO therapy prevents progression in patients with mild to moderate COVID-19 disease.

COVID-19: BCG As Therapeutic Vaccine, Transmission Limitation, and Immunoglobulin Enhancement

COVID-19Therapeutic Vaccine3 more

To date, there is no vaccine or treatment with proven efficiency against COVID-19, and the transmissibility of the SARS-CoV-2 virus can be inferred by its identification in the oro-nasopharynx. The bacillus Calmette Guérin (BCG) has the potential for cross-protection against viral infections. This study evaluates the impact of previous (priming effect, from the titer of anti-BCG interferon-gamma) or current BCG exposure (boost with intradermal vaccine) on 1) clinical evolution of COVID-19; 2) elimination of SARS-CoV-2 at different times and disease phenotypes; and 3) seroconversion rate and titration (anti-SARS-CoV-2 IgA, IgM, and IgG).
